
Wimbledon Moments: When Royalty Meets the Thrill of Tennis
The crowd at Wimbledon witnessed a delightful surprise, as Prince George and Princess Charlotte made a charming appearance at the men's singles final on July 13th. With their parents, Kate Middleton and Prince William, the young royals brought an air of excitement and a splash of royal charm amidst fierce competition on the court. But it was the lively reactions of 10-year-old Princess Charlotte that truly captivated fans both in the stands and at home.

Kate Middleton: Resilience at the Forefront
As Charlotte and George cheered and grimaced throughout the intense match, their mother, Kate Middleton, proudly took to her role as the patron of the All England Lawn Tennis and Croquet Club. Since her appointment by the late Queen Elizabeth II, Kate has put her heart into supporting tennis in Britain, and this day was no different. Coming off a year where she publicly shared her battle with cancer—now announced to be in remission—each trophy she presented represented resilience and a celebration of life's moments.
